ABOUT L'ARCHE KENT
We are people with and without learning disability, on a mission to build a world where everyone belongs. As a movement of life-sharing Communities, we help each other live full and empowered lives, enriched with belonging, kindness, creativity, fun and joy.We seek every opportunity to celebrate the gifts and contributions of people with learning disabilities. We lookto grow by building mutual relationships across our diversity and differences, and to work together for a more human society.
L'Arche Kent is the oldest of the 11 UK L'Arche communities, calling Canterbury a home since 1974.Our Community includes currently 28 people with learning disabilities, who we support at home, as well as volunteers, friends, neighbours and L'Arche assistants. Some of the people we support choose to live in their own flat, others prefer to share their home with one or more housemates who have a learning disability and perhaps with L'Arche assistants as well.
